Location! Location!... Wonderful opportunity to own a lovely home in the highly desirable Princess-Rosethorn neighbourhood with large backyard and oversized deck. Upon entering the welcoming foyer you're greeted by a bright combined living and dining area with a large bay window, hardwood floors and a floor-to-ceiling mirrored accent wall. Primary bedroom perfectly configured for new parents with open concept to nursery and can be easily converted back into a 3-bedroom layout. The main floor offers a 4 piece bathroom. This updated home features refreshed kitchen cabinetry with convenient access to the basement. Beautifully finished basement with a separate side entrance with an additional bedroom ideal for a nanny suite, guest room, home gym, office - you name it - and 3pc bathroom with heated floors. The lower-level family room is perfect for family gathering, with a second cozy fireplace, two windows and custom-built white shelving/cabinetry. Laminate flooring and pot lights throughout creating a bright and welcoming atmosphere. This bungalow is an incredible opportunity for first-time buyers, investors or those looking to build a new home. Located in one of Etobicoke's highly rated/coveted school area, close to parks and convenient, accessible transportation.

Who lives here?

Princess-Rosethorn,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business, science and education, law & public sector professionals.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of kids aged 10 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24, adults aged 50 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 74.
